Kevin Guskiewicz to stay at MSU
- 331 words
President Kevin Guskiewicz is staying at Michigan State University.
A source close to Michigan State University told The State News Monday that Guskiewicz will stay at the university following his announcement he would join Clemson University.
The source also added that the MSU is not looking to retain Athletic Director J Batt after his departure to University of Kentucky.
In a post shared to X, Clemson University wrote that “The Clemson University Board of Trustees was notified today that Kevin Guskiewicz has chosen to remain at Michigan State University for personal reasons.”
On May 27, Clemson’s board voted unanimously to welcome Guskiewicz as its 16th president. In a community letter on the way out, Guskiewicz placed blame on certain members of the Board of Trustees for his departure.
Signs covered East Lansing following his resignation reading “We (heart) KG,” signaling community support for the departing president as others mobilized against the Board of Trustees.
Weeks after Guskiewicz’s departure announcement, Batt was hired for the same position at the University of Kentucky on June 15. It is currently unclear when his last day at MSU will be.
At the time of publication, Batt is listed on the staff directories of both MSU and the University of Kentucky.
If Guskiewicz were to have left MSU, Batt’s buyout would have been reduced from $5 million to $2.5 million.
MSU could not be reached for comment at the time of publication.
